Output 730561981052e0c735355d022fa95627292ec4ed44ad2da745704f9bad77baa0:21

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91fe1bf284b2816259327d26e68b26683545868e7f64be7e2f8efac8ef063e04
address
bc1pj8lphu5yk2qkykfj05nwdzexdq65tp5w0ajtul303mav3mcx8czq2fc995
transaction
730561981052e0c735355d022fa95627292ec4ed44ad2da745704f9bad77baa0
spent
true